Description

This compound belongs to the class of organic compounds known as benzotriazole ribonucleosides and ribonucleotides. These are nucleosides with a structure that consists of an imidazole moiety of benzotriazole is N-linked to a ribose (or deoxyribose). Nucleotides have a phosphate group linked to the C5 carbon of the ribose (or deoxyribose) moiety.
